Abstract

Method and apparatus for frequency domain modulation optical fiber communication particularly useful for digital and analog signal transmission comprising, in the order recited, a plurality of parallel-connected signal input units each incorporating individual laser sources provided with means modulating the output radiations of said laser sources responsive to individual signal inputs, thereby establishing, for each signal input, an individual optical information wave train, a collimating lens, an acousto-optical modulator means introducing a sub-carrier signal developing a beat frequency with said optical information wave train, an optical fiber coupler transmitting the resulting signal through an optical fiber to a common square law detector and an information receiver isolating a preselected individual signal input according to its associated individual sub-carrier frequency, said individual sub-carrier frequencies being spaced one from another by an interval forestalling interference in the reception of said individual signal inputs.
